About the School

  • Kids Place At The Vna in Dedham, MA offers early childhood education for grades PK–K in a nonsectarian, urban setting.
  • The school enrolls 28 students with a student–teacher ratio of 28:1 supported by one teacher on staff.
  • Kids Place At The Vna serves a small, co–ed population focusing on preschool and kindergarten–age children.
